[Remote] 2026 Summer Internship Program: Global Development Compliance Intern

Remote, USA Full-time
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. Takeda is a global biopharmaceutical company committed to bringing better health and a brighter future to patients. As a Global Development Compliance Intern, you will support focused projects that enhance efficiency and streamline processes in Clinical Development, while gaining valuable experience in Good Clinical Practice and clinical trial delivery. Responsibilities Support overall development of new or revised Good Clinical Practice (GCP) and Clinical Trial Delivery processes and/or training content (may include supporting process map development and refinement, SOPs, RACIs, and developing training content) Support translation of process maps into Takeda systems Help prepare for, facilitate and support project workshops with key subject matter experts (SMEs) Partner with stakeholders and key SMEs to update and/or create documentation and/or training content Initiate and facilitate review and feedback for GCP SOPs, process maps, and/or training content Provide weekly status updates to project teams and manage project plans and action/decision logs Skills Must be pursuing a Bachelor's, Master's, or Doctoral degree in a scientific, business, or relevant discipline Must be authorized to work in the U.S. on a permanent basis without requiring sponsorship Must be currently enrolled in a degree program graduating December 2026 or later Able to work full time 40 hours a week during internship dates Adept at utilizing computer software programs (e.g., Microsoft Office and Excel), project management and collaboration tools (e.g., SharePoint, Teams) to efficiently organize and execute projects Strong problem-solving abilities and attention to detail Effective communication skills and ability to influence stakeholder engagement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and prioritize tasks Benefits Paid sick time Civic Duty paid time off Participation at company volunteer events Participation at company sponsored special events Access to on-site fitness center (where available) Commuter Benefit To offset your work-commute expenses, Takeda provides U.S. employees with a fixed monthly subsidy to be used for either public transportation (transit) or parking.
